Resource Type definition for AWS::Evidently::Project

Using getProject

Two invocation forms are available. The direct form accepts plain arguments and either blocks until the result value is available, or returns a Promise-wrapped result. The output form accepts Input-wrapped arguments and returns an Output-wrapped result.

function getProject(args: GetProjectArgs, opts?: InvokeOptions): Promise<GetProjectResult>
function getProjectOutput(args: GetProjectOutputArgs, opts?: InvokeOptions): Output<GetProjectResult>

getProject Result

The following output properties are available:

AppConfigResource Pulumi.AwsNative.Evidently.Outputs.ProjectAppConfigResourceObject

Use this parameter if the project will use client-side evaluation powered by AWS AppConfig . Client-side evaluation allows your application to assign variations to user sessions locally instead of by calling the EvaluateFeature operation. This mitigates the latency and availability risks that come with an API call. For more information, see Use client-side evaluation - powered by AWS AppConfig .

This parameter is a structure that contains information about the AWS AppConfig application that will be used as for client-side evaluation.

To create a project that uses client-side evaluation, you must have the evidently:ExportProjectAsConfiguration permission.

Arn string
The ARN of the project. For example, arn:aws:evidently:us-west-2:0123455678912:project/myProject
DataDelivery Pulumi.AwsNative.Evidently.Outputs.ProjectDataDeliveryObject

A structure that contains information about where Evidently is to store evaluation events for longer term storage, if you choose to do so. If you choose not to store these events, Evidently deletes them after using them to produce metrics and other experiment results that you can view.

You can't specify both CloudWatchLogs and S3Destination in the same operation.

Description string
An optional description of the project.
Tags List<Pulumi.AwsNative.Outputs.Tag>
An array of key-value pairs to apply to this resource.

Supporting Types

ProjectAppConfigResourceObject

ApplicationId This property is required. string
The ID of the AWS AppConfig application to use for client-side evaluation.
EnvironmentId This property is required. string
The ID of the AWS AppConfig environment to use for client-side evaluation.

ProjectDataDeliveryObject

LogGroup string
If the project stores evaluation events in CloudWatch Logs , this structure stores the log group name.
S3 Pulumi.AwsNative.Evidently.Inputs.ProjectS3Destination
If the project stores evaluation events in an Amazon S3 bucket, this structure stores the bucket name and bucket prefix.

ProjectS3Destination

BucketName This property is required. string
The name of the bucket in which Evidently stores evaluation events.
Prefix string
The bucket prefix in which Evidently stores evaluation events.
